There are only a few people who live their entire lives in the Imperial Palace. Even the Emperor failed to live solely in the palace in many cases, but what about his predecessors?

 

What about an Empress who has no family power?

 

“Please. Please—”

 

The boy ran. He had to be able to get a hold of anyone. Even the Empress, who sees him as a worm most of the time, or his Aunt, who always pastes on a smiling face to learn the subject, or even the Emperor, his father, whose face is the least clear in his mind.

 

In the Empress’ Palace, his mother was dying. She had spit up blood. The child realized that no one nearby could help him, so he hurried to find someone who could.

 

Even so, someone is dying, therefore he should probably call a doctor. Even if he is not physically capable as a child, if a member of the royal family summons them, everyone will rush to him. 

 

But there was no one.

 

“Please save me— Save me—”

 

No one responded to him no matter how many times he walked around the huge palace, crying. Nobody cared about his repeated pleas for life. The doctors are said to have all taken business trips.

 

There was nothing he could do to save his mother’s life.

 

It was the first time he found out that Innis had ordered everyone in the Palace to ignore him for one day.

“The Marchioness Innis Rhodein is said to have stayed at the Duke of Edenbert.” 

 

“I thought it was because the Marquis Rhodein was the Duke of Edenbert’s cousin. She would return to her estate quietly if she was kicked out.”

 

He’s in trouble. Ethelred rests his hand on his forehead. Innis, who came to the Palace like a comet a few days ago, requested an empty Palace using the excuse of the Emperor’s aunt, but all requests were denied by a competent prime minister who knew his lord’s wishes all too well.

 

‘Ah, I’ll get you a place in the Palace. I can’t treat you poorly because you’re His Majesty’s aunt. So, let’s have a look. Citus’ Palace and Heilo’s Palace are both empty. It’ll probably be a little dusty, but being alone won’t hurt. Where do you want to go?’

 

Kir has memorized all of the palaces that are known as “cold palaces.” It is unnecessary to convey how angry and trembling Innis was when she realized what was going on.

 

Kir’s cheeks swelled significantly as a result of this, but he said he was pleased with it because he rarely heard Ethelred’s compliments. He pounded the bottom of the paperwork he was holding on the table a few times to align them neatly, then placed it on Ethelred’s table.

 

“I’m sure she’s thinking of attending the party.”

 

“She came all the way here to see Maribelle, of course.”

 

That’s why Ethelred said ‘I’m in trouble’.

 

When Ethelred dances with a sword that kills people, it’s only in the Imperial Palace that he has no one to interfere with him. However it can’t be done during a party where there are many people watching. Furthermore, aristocrats who make a living out of vanity would be much more offended by Ethelred’s murderous appearance.

 

“…I want to kill them all.”

 

“I know what you mean, but please fix it. The opposition from the nobles is already overwhelming.”

 

“I know. That’s what I said. All right, go ahead.”

 

Ethelred waved his hand to let Kir out, then wiped his confused face with his other hand. He couldn’t think about the nobles’ gaze on Maribelle since he was so focused on the immediate issue—the former Crown Prince Baldwin and the rebellion.

 

No, it’s untrue to say he didn’t consider it.

 

The title “tyrant” wasn’t given lightly. Ethelred carried out his will regardless of what the nobles thought. He can kill them if they oppose it. However Maribelle’s situation could not be solved in the same way.

 

There has already been a lot of backlash, as Kir said. Apart from the tyrant, there is no one else. Nothing is wrong with those words.

 

At this point, there are no nobles on the side of Ethelred. There is no noticeable backlash for now, but one sidedly forcing them  would do nothing more than blindfold himself and leave him at a disadvantage.

 

Ethelred is unaffected by the nobles’ hatred. Clearly, no one could touch him. Maribelle, however, is not like that, she’s easily reached. Especially now since Innis has expressed an interest in attending the party.

 

They would not have thought of harming Maribelle if it hadn’t been for Innis, but the story is different with Innis around. In the woman’s social circle, the title of Emperor’s Aunt is more powerful than the emperor.

 

Ethelred has only one ‘protective device’ he can provide Maribelle in this situation. The title of Empress.

 

“Your Majesty, the Duke’s Young Lady, Maribelle Edenbert, has come.”

 

Ethelred nodded, and the servant hurriedly opened the door. Maribelle was holding a flower in her hands, with her hair tied back in a half ponytail. She walked into his office and scattered the tense atmosphere briefly after greeting him pleasantly.

 

“I heard you looking for me. I’m visiting you in Igcentium for the first time. No, this is the second time, right?”

 

Maribelle was speaking in a soft tone, and Ethelred was distracted by the flowers in Maribelle’s hands, otherwise he would typically have recognized that she was excited today.

 

“—Flowers?”

 

“Ah, this.”

 

Maribelle’s cheeks are flushed, and it may not be just the mood.

 

“Pepper— Because Your Majesty was calling, my nanny told me to go get it and give it to you. I believe there was a misunderstanding.”

 

“Easy enough to guess, it’s a gift.”

 

“Isn’t there a meaning of bribery?”

 

It must have meant to show Your Majesty better— Ethelred, who looked at Maribelle as she continued talking to herself, smiled brightly as he suddenly realized the tension he had been carrying since he saw Innis had been relieved.

 

“Give it to me. You should pass it over to me since she told you to give it to me.”

 

“Are you suggesting I bribe you with my own hands?”

 

“Is it really a bribe if the recipient receives it as a pure gift?”

 

Ethelred held his hand out to hers and closed his eyes. He is inquiring since he does not believe it is a bribe. There’s no need to refuse because he’s so considerate.

 

Maribelle made her way over to Ethelred. The Emperor’s subjects couldn’t stand at the same eye level in the Emperor’s original office, therefore the Emperor’s desk was raised a step. But it meant she couldn’t give Ethelred flowers since it was hard to go up in her heavy dress.

 

Going up there is also a sign of authority, but Ethelred had approved her coming up there therefore it should be okay to do so.

 

‘Can I go up for a while and then come down?’

 

Her shoes echoed through the quiet office as she walked on the long carpet in the middle of the room. Ethelred’s hand would be within reach after three more steps.

 

Maribelle felt like sharing secrets for no reason, and placed the bouquet of flowers, which she had held dearly, in Ethelred’s hand.

 

‘—Huh?’

 

She thought His Majesty would just accept the bouquet. 

 

Maribelle fell on top of Ethelred the next moment. What exactly is going on here? Maribelle recognized she had fallen into his trap only when her eyes, which were wandering around in confusion to try and calm her surprised heart, met Ethelred’s calm ones.

 

This means Ethelred had been deceiving her from the start in order to get Maribelle closer to him.

 

Ethelred would not have been smiling happily as he stared at Maribelle, who had fallen over him like a smug lion, if it hadn’t been for that.

 

“There’s a petal in your hair.”

 

Ethelred wanted to stroke Maribelle’s hair, but he placed a bouquet of flowers in front of her that she had been carrying for quite some time.

 

“The bribes went down beautifully.”

 

“…Tricking people is a bad thing.”

 

Maribelle complained, but Ethelred remained undisturbed. He made a grumpy face and placed the flowers Maribelle had brought to his desk.

 

“Should I remind you that I am a bad person? Many people believe that being deceived isn’t the worst thing I can do.”

 

“That’s nonsense—!”

 

“Am I wrong?”

 

Maribelle lifted her head, and realized the moment she saw Ethelred smiling with a relaxed face. No matter what she says she can’t beat him.

 

“—Okay, I lost. Let me go.’

 

“Don’t be angry, it’s a joke.”

 

Maribelle was gently released by Ethelred. Maribelle felt both curious and embarrassed as a result of this unexpected turn of events. It’s embarrassing that she believed he wouldn’t let go.

 

‘You seem to be in a good mood today.’

 

Look, nanny, there’s nothing to worry about.

 

The flowers that Maribelle brought were obviously a bribe.

 

Maribelle and Pepper had an argument before going to Igcentium at Ethelred’s request.

 

‘Nanny, don’t be too worried. What’s the deal with the flower?’

 

‘Gifts are unquestionably useful in calming your nerves, Lady! Especially if it’s a flower from a beautiful woman.’

 

‘No, what beautiful person— What if His Majesty doesn’t like flowers?’

 

‘I’m sure he’ll like it. Trust this nanny!’

 

Pepper was concerned that Ethelred would be harsh with Maribelle when she entered Ethelred’s office. So she tried to soften his heart by giving him a gift that will humble him—but Maribelle thinks that’s ridiculous.

 

‘His Majesty is always like that to me, even when there are no flowers.’

 

He said she’s special. Maribelle kept her mouth shut because she didn’t know how to describe the sticky sensation rising from her heart, but the talk in the garden that day stayed with her.

 

His Majesty considers her to be a special person. Maribelle seemed to be walking on clouds on her way to Ethelred, as if she left a trail of flowers on every road she took. It was quite strange.

 

Maribelle’s mind was also consumed by her ethereal mood. Maribelle was just where she had hoped to be. She might be able to declare now that she could become the Empress because of these expectations.

 

Because their feelings and trust are so strong, His Majesty will be able to understand her wishes. Even if she claims she wants to succeed as the Empress, which he has previously accepted, he will most likely allow her to do as she liked without questioning her, as he has in the past.

 

She had forgotten the betrayal and need for revenge that had developed as a result of these kinds of expectations. What if this was a drizzle that caused her to become soaked without her recognizing it?

 

Ethelred only realized that she was so soft today after Maribelle took a step back.

 

She’s as hard as a blade when cold, yet can be so lovely as her coldness melts away. He can’t help but wonder at his obsession because Maribelle’s appearance wasn’t particularly remarkable to him.

 

For a little while, Ethelred suppressed his greed and uttered a few words. It was spoken in such a way that someone who is frequently referred to as a gentleman would be shamed.

 

“Only the Emperor and Empress are permitted to enter. What are your thoughts on coming up here?”

 

“It’s quite high. If I sat here and looked down at the people, I suppose everything in the world would appear ridiculous.”

 

“Do you like it?”

 

Ethelred continued without waiting for Maribelle’s reply. She had already accepted the position of Empress in the first place, so her answer was not very important.

 

“I told you the other day. I’ll give you a place at my side.”

 

“Oh, yes. You know—”

 

“As soon as possible, I intend to have you by my side. But first, let me ask you a question. You know”

 

This isn’t right. Maribelle looked at the man in front of her in despair. He seemed to be soft and pleasant. Maribelle believed that if she claimed she would now hold down the position of Empress, Ethelred would not be offended.

 

But why isn’t her jaw opening?

 

“I’d like to know who the treasonous mastermind is. That way, I’ll be able to put my whole trust in you.”

 

Maribelle finally realized when she came face to face with Ethelred’s trusting face.

 

Oh. She’s let herself go too far.

 

The topic of revenge was no longer an issue. The dread of losing his love, along with the trust in that dazzling face showed her, she couldn’t take the idea that she would no longer be ‘special’ to him.

 

She doesn’t want to see the dissatisfaction on that person’s face.

 

‘Oh, my goodness.’

 

Maribelle couldn’t help but be surprised when the thought came to her. When did she develop such a strong bond with him? She couldn’t believe she was so blind. Drizzly clothes can’t be the only thing that gets wet.

 

Maribelle’s cards, the few she still had, were still securely in her grip. Can she be sure it’s ‘always’ safe, though?

 

In a rush, Maribelle looked down. Her hand was covered in a bandage, which she saw. The hand she cut with her own sword.

 

‘Are you in pain right now?’

 

She thought she had heard Azil’s voice.
